...Kodak EasyShare LS633 zoom digital camera Lens Type Optical quality glass, 6 groups/7 elements (2 aspherical surfaces) Aperture Maximum f/2.7 - SD Card or MMC Pixel resolution Best: 2032 x 1524 (3.1 M) pixels Best (3:2): 2032 x 1354 (2.8 M) pixels Better: 1656 x 1242 (2.1 M) pixels Good: 1200 x 900 (1.0 M) pixels Video resolution 320 x 240 pixels, 15 fps Power Battery... Li-Ion rechargeable 3.7V, 1050mAH AC adapter 5V DC (included with camera dock 6000) Self Timer 10 seconds Tripod socket 1/4-inch Video Out ...
